COLOUR PENCIL lollies

A popular subject of the Pop Art movement was food! so we are going to be using food as our subject matter to complete a colour pencil study.

You can choose to select a photograph already taken of some lollies or you can do your own photograph [either at home or at school] It is REALLY important to have good natural lighting and a plain background. At school use the small lightboxes to do our photograph.

PROCESS:

Print your photo

WATCH THE SKITTLES TIME LAPSE AND DO'S & DONT'S VIDEOS

  1. Use a printed grid over the top and lightly draw your grid on your drawing paper [skip this step if freehand drawing]

  2. lightly sketch in the contour lines of your food/lolly. Erase any dark lines - you should barely be able to see any graphite. FULLY remove any grid lines

  3. start to build up colour with your pencils.
